What is Fernando Baeza known for?

Fernando Baeza is known for acting, with notable films including Red Gold (1978) as Walter, Die Quelle (1979) as Captain, and Robin Hood, Arrow, Beans and Karate (1976).

What genres does Fernando Baeza's filmography span?

Fernando Baeza's filmography spans the genres of Comedy, Drama, Adventure, and Thriller.

What era does Fernando Baeza's work cover?

Fernando Baeza's work covers the years from 1975 to 1979, with his most active decade being the 1970s.

How many films are in Fernando Baeza's filmography?

Fernando Baeza has a total of 5 films listed in his filmography.

What are some notable films in Fernando Baeza's filmography?

Notable films in Fernando Baeza's filmography include Red Gold (1978), Die Quelle (1979), Robin Hood, Arrow, Beans and Karate (1976), Amor casi... libre (1976), and The Student of Salamanca (1975).
